Understanding Personalised Home Care

Personalised home care provides professional support tailored to each individual’s unique needs. Instead of following a standard routine used in many residential settings, carers create a care plan based on the client’s health, lifestyle, and personal preferences.

Services may include:

  • Personal care
  • Live-in care
  • Visiting care
  • Companionship care
  • Medication reminders
  • Meal preparation
  • Household assistance
  • Shopping and errands
  • Mobility support
  • Respite care

This flexible approach ensures that every client receives the right level of support while remaining independent.


1. Stay in the Comfort of Your Own Home

One of the biggest benefits of personalised home care is remaining in familiar surroundings. Home provides comfort, security, and emotional stability. Being surrounded by personal belongings, treasured memories, and loved ones often reduces anxiety and promotes overall wellbeing.

Unlike moving into a care home, individuals can continue living in the environment they know best.


2. Individual Care Plans

Every person has different needs. Personalised home care focuses entirely on the individual rather than following a one-size-fits-all schedule.

A care plan can include:

  • Morning and evening routines
  • Personal hygiene support
  • Medication assistance
  • Meal planning
  • Social activities
  • Mobility support
  • Health monitoring

Care plans can also be adjusted as needs change over time.


3. Greater Independence

Home care encourages people to stay active and involved in daily life. Instead of completing every task for the client, carers provide support while encouraging independence wherever possible.

This helps maintain confidence, physical ability, and emotional wellbeing.


4. One-to-One Attention

Unlike residential care homes where staff care for multiple residents at the same time, home care provides dedicated one-to-one support.

This means:

  • More personalised attention
  • Better communication
  • Stronger relationships with carers
  • Faster response to changing needs

5. Family Involvement

Home care makes it easier for families to remain involved in the care process.

Family members can:

  • Visit whenever they wish
  • Participate in care planning
  • Stay informed about progress
  • Continue spending meaningful time together

This creates reassurance for everyone involved.


6. Flexible Care Options

Personalised home care can be adapted to suit changing circumstances.

Options include:

  • Hourly visits
  • Daily care
  • Overnight care
  • Live-in care
  • Temporary respite care
  • Long-term support

Families only pay for the level of care required.


7. Emotional Wellbeing

Remaining at home allows individuals to continue enjoying familiar hobbies, neighbours, pets, and local communities.

Maintaining these daily routines often contributes to:

  • Reduced loneliness
  • Better mental health
  • Increased confidence
  • Improved quality of life

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is personalised home care?

Personalised home care provides tailored support based on an individual’s unique needs, preferences, and daily routine while allowing them to remain at home.

2. Is home care better than a residential care home?

It depends on the individual’s needs. Many people prefer home care because it offers one-to-one support, independence, and the comfort of familiar surroundings.

3. Can home care be adjusted as needs change?

Yes. Care plans are regularly reviewed and can be updated to match changing health conditions or personal requirements.

4. Do family members stay involved?

Yes. Families can remain actively involved in care planning and continue spending quality time with their loved ones.

5. What services are included in personalised home care?

Services may include personal care, companionship, medication reminders, meal preparation, mobility support, housekeeping, and live-in care.
